Mr. Liebeler. Did you go to your place of business at any time, to the Bell Helicopter plant on that day?

Mr. Paine. Well, my apartment was close by it. I think somebody has asked me this question before and I think at the time I said no, and I don't remember now, that is my closest memory to that occasion.

Mr. Liebeler. Your recollection is that you did not go to the helicopter plant?

Mr. Paine. My recollection now is now fuzzier than ever but I recall previously I thought about it and I said, no.

Mr. Liebeler. Did you go to the police station in Dallas on Saturday?

Mr. Paine. Yes. I recall the FBI came, not the FBI, the Dallas police came and took me in their car. We went back via Grand Prairie which was out of the way and the sun was about setting so that was about 5:30.

Mr. Liebeler. Did you come back to Irving after you left the Dallas Police Department?

Mr. Paine. Yes, probably 8 or 9 at night.

Mr. Liebeler. Did you stay at Irving that evening?

Mr. Paine. I think I probably stayed Saturday evening and went back, spent Sunday evening in Grand Prairie so I could get to work easily the next morning.
